Concrete foundation repair methods are closely related to a variety of property issues and renovation plans. Foundations can develop problems due to soil movement, moisture changes, or poor initial construction. These issues can compromise the structural integrity of a home or commercial building, prompting repairs to prevent further damage. Repair methods aim to address specific problems like settling, cracking, or shifting, often involving techniques such as underpinning, mudjacking, or piering. Homeowners typically seek this information when planning repairs or considering improvements that ensure their property remains safe and stable over the years.
The types of properties that commonly require concrete foundation repair include single-family homes, multi-family complexes, and small commercial buildings. Residential properties with basements or crawl spaces are particularly susceptible to foundation issues, especially in areas with expansive or shifting soil. Older homes are often more prone to foundation problems due to aging materials and construction methods. Commercial properties, especially those with large or complex structures, may also need foundation repairs to maintain safety and operational stability.
